 PRINTER OPERATION AND PROGRAMMING 
 
The Ap1310-DC utilises a Fujitsu FTP-628MCL103 printer mechanism, with a fixed (parallel) print 
head with 384 horizontally-arranged thermal elements.  The paper is advanced by a stepper motor, 
and printing takes place in a single dot row for each step of the paper.  Each printed dot is 
approximately 1/8 mm square.  The printing speed and dot density are controlled according to the 
power supply voltage and the head temperature. 
 
Various printing modes, including graphics, are invoked by 'Escape' sequences.  Control codes and 
status report protocols are described in detail in the Programmers' Guide, available separately.  
 
6.1 
DATA BUFFER  
 
The Ap1310-DC has a nominal 20k byte buffer to optimise throughput: this enables data to be 
received into the buffer while previous lines are being printed.  Printing will be initiated on receipt of a 
valid logical line of data or a complete graphics pattern.   
 
The buffer may be cleared by data command or by a hardware reset.  A partially full line will be 
printed on receipt of an appropriate control code, or after a programmable timeout delay.   
 
6.2 SPOOL 
MODE 
 
Spool mode is can be entered by: 
 
a command from the host; 
 
Paper Out condition or Head Up condition being sensed;  
 
an error condition (e.g. head over temperature, power supply over voltage, etc). 
 
In spool mode, the buffered data are stored without being printed until the mode is exited by: 
 
a command from the host;  
 
the 'causing condition' (e.g. Paper Out or Head Up) being cleared; 
 
the paper feed button being double-clicked. 
 
 
 
6.3 
CHARACTER PRINTING AND FONTS 
 
The default 32-column character set is formed from a 24x10 dot matrix, and is based on the industry 
standard IBM® character set Code Page 437.  This character set has been modified to include the 
Euro symbol (‘€’) at position 80H (128 Decimal), in place of the usual capital C with cedilla (‘Ç’). 
 
Various combinations of single or double width, single or double height, inverted, underlined, and 
other attributes may be mixed within a line.   
 
Customised fonts may be created using the Able Systems Font Editor Utility, and downloaded to the 
Ap1310-DC.  Only a single custom font may be loaded in the printer at one time, and having a custom 
font installed prevents the internal fonts from being accessed.  Depending on the attributes of the 
custom font, graphics operations, and hence operation with the Windows driver, may be affected. 
 
6.4 
GRAPHICS PRINTING AND OTHER PROGRAMMING MODES 
 
Various dot-addressable graphics modes are supported, at up to 384 dots per line.  The Windows 
driver operates in the graphics mode. Refer to the Programmer’s Guide for full details of this and other 
advanced programming modes.
